Texas Deadly Floods Kill 27, Dozens Children Missing
Severe flash flooding in central Texas has caused the Guadalupe River to rise rapidly, resulting in at least 27 deaths, including nine children, and dozens of people missing, many of whom are young girls from Camp Mystic, a Christian all-girls summer camp near Kerrville. Rescue operations are ongoing, with over 800 people rescued so far, but the search continues for more missing children. Texas officials, including Governor Greg Abbott and Lieutenant Governor Dan Patrick, who was acting governor during the floods, have expressed their heartbreak and are actively involved in recovery efforts, with Patrick sharing emotional reflections on the tragic losses. President Donald Trump and Vice President JD Vance have publicly offered condolences and prayers, with the administration coordinating with state and local officials and sending Secretary of Homeland Security Kristi Noem to the area. Lawmakers across party lines have also responded with prayers and support, emphasizing the commitment to providing whatever assistance Texas needs during this crisis. The tragedy has deeply affected the community and officials alike as they grapple with the devastating impact of the flooding.
